While I generally agree with Dick's comments, I think that Ti's original comments did have some basis too. If the developers are working in a limited environment where there is a small number of supported boards (whether they are made internally or by an outside party) they can spend more time after getting it working to get it working really well. If they must support every piece of hardware that any customer might happen to add on, then it is quite possible that they never reach the stage where all the combinations are working and they have time to work on the optimization. Often, if you have to work with a large number of differrent types of hardware, you may decide to skip any optimizations that require a change to each hardware-specific device driver. There *is* a qualitive difference between doing a large number of things well and doing a smaller number of things better. Depending upon the number and quality of people that each manufacturer has, it is not however impossible to do either a large number of things better or a small number of things worse, however...
